okachimachi (accessible by JR Yamanote line) - place to stock up snacks. once you exit the train station, you should see a traffic light crossing. do not cross and turn to your right and walk. walk all the way down n u will see another traffic light crossing. in front of there is a big purple building called takeya. that is 1 place to get the stuff. i usually get my milk tea from there. next, still remb tat traffic light crossing at the train station? cross that and walk straight into the lane. you can slowly shop there. some stalls even sell fresh seafood like salmon. looks damn fresh. at the first turn on your left, turn left. then you will see a few shops down the road is the snacks shop. next to it is a tiny shrine which is barely noticable. that is shop no 2 you can get your snacks n sauces. i even bgt instant noodles back coz it is so much cheaper.. in sg, it cost more than double the price i think. in okachimachi, you will see a few shops whereby it has a vending machine for food. quite cheap n nice. there is one shop i always patronize but very difficult to describe to you.

hakone has alot of nice hotsprings inns.. the one i stayed is quite expensive but nice.. got both indoor and outdoor onsen.. the dinner provided is damn huge.. i stayed there for 1 nite so it comes with wide spread of dinner plus simple breakfast.. but bear in mind, most inns do not allow males and females to share the same onsen.. only very few inns allow you to do tat.. n before you go to the onsen pool, you must shower yourself which is provided otherwise, ppl will scold you! after soaking in onsen, you will shower again! ahaha...
